Wild Goose Dreams review " endearing online-offline romance by Miriam Gillinson

Ustinov Studio, Bath Hansol Jung's play brings the distracting, confusing noise of the internet to a funny and sensitive story of lonely hearts in Seoul The internet is so fully realised in this production that even a dialling tone has personality (watch it angrily slope off the stage). As two lonely folks navigate life in modern-day Seoul, and look for love on the internet, a small chorus of actors chirp, sing and d…
